How We Got Here

When we started this company as H2Ok Innovations, our mission was clear: help food and beverage manufacturers become better stewards of one of their most precious resources—water. 

H2Ok Innovations was born from that purpose, and we’re proud of the impact we’ve had. Our technology has helped global leaders reduce water usage by as much as 20%, a meaningful contribution in an industry where every liter matters.

But as we’ve grown, so has our technology. The same spectral sensing and AI that helped save water also revealed new possibilities. Today, we don’t just conserve resources—we give factories back their most valuable commodity: time. 

Our sensors and agentic AI now help manufacturers shorten Clean-in-Place cycles, run faster product changeovers, prevent product loss, and reduce downtime. That means savings not just in water and chemicals, but in cutting product loss, preventing downtime, and recovering lost production capacity. 

We’re not just tackling one challenge—we’re transforming the future of process manufacturing by helping each factory operate at its best.

This evolution to a broader mission called for a new name.

Why Laminar

We chose Laminar because it reflects both who we are and what we’re building. 

Laminar flow represents a more predictable, more energy-efficient, and more desired state, especially in processes where “exactness” is desired. Although difficult to achieve in fast-moving systems, it is the ideal, just as we bring science-backed order to the turbulent (or chaotic, irregular) environment in manufacturing.

Laminar flows are smooth and streamlined, whereas turbulent flows are irregular and chaotic.

Operationally, Laminar conveys clarity and smoothness. Predictability, efficiency, and clear flow mean transparency across a factory. Smooth flow means operations that are easier, more predictable, and proactive — running in real time, not on lagging signals.

The name resonated with our team as a symbol of striving for the best version of ourselves. Just as our people strive to improve our company and technology with each innovation, we want factories to unlock their best version — one that is more efficient, agile, and sustainable.

At its core, Laminar embodies our mission: bringing clarity, precision, and smoothness to every factory, enabling them to operate at their very best.
